Capturing the Future in a Flash

Imagine a world where renovating your home, settling an insurance claim, or designing a new space is as simple as taking a picture with your smartphone. This isn't a distant future scenario; it's happening right now, thanks to innovative technologies like the one developed by Hosta a.i. This technology transforms images into detailed property assessments, including precise measurements, 3D models, and material conditions. It's revolutionizing industries by making processes faster, more accurate, and less costly. Artificial intelligence (AI)

A branch of computer science dealing with the creation of machines that can perform tasks that typically require human intelligence, such as visual perception, speech recognition, decision-making, and translation between languages.

Computer-aided design (CAD)

A type of software that allows architects, engineers, and designers to create precise drawings and technical illustrations of buildings, mechanical parts, and other complex objects.

3D modeling

The process of developing a mathematical representation of any surface of an object in three dimensions via specialized software.
